Check For Errors In Your Hospital Bill

Saturday, January 10th, 2009

Having medical insurance is no guarantee you won’t be overbilled. Many are finding inaccuracies in the bills they receive from hospitals and caregivers. The problem is less uncommon than one would think. It could be sloppiness or it could mean the right hand isn’t talking to the left hand. Hospital billing procedures often do leave a lot to be desired, since there are so many involved in the patient’s care. But errors do occur, and it is a good idea to do a line by line review of your hospital bill.

Floridians To Have Access To Health Coverage In 2009

Friday, December 26th, 2008

The new Cover Florida Health Care Program goes into effect on January 5, 2009. Under the bill that Governor Charlie Christ signed in May of 2008, uninsured residents will be able to buy health care insurance. There are some restrictions to the program, however.

Insurance for Non US Citizen & Preferred Provider Network

Thursday, December 18th, 2008

Doctors, hospitals and health care providers comprise groups called PPOs, or preferred provider organizations. These PPO groups, also called “networks”, then agree to provide services at a discounted rate for insurance companies. PPO immigrant insurance contain several positive and negative features for providers and patients.
